Key Highlights

PDBC’s core value proposition rests on two key structural and operational advantages that set it apart from peer commodity funds. First, its C-corporation wrapper eliminates the need for investors to receive complex K-1 tax forms, instead issuing a standard 1099 form annually, reducing administrative friction for taxable brokerage account holders and eliminating the risk of unrelated business taxable income (UBTI) for IRA investors. Expert Insights

From a portfolio construction perspective, PDBC fills a longstanding gap in the retail investment product ecosystem for accessible commodity exposure. Historically, many investors avoided commodity allocations entirely due to K-1 administrative burdens: tax filers often face delayed filings, additional accounting fees, and UBTI liabilities in retirement accounts when holding partnership-structured commodity funds, which PDBC’s C-corp structure fully eliminates. For investors targeting a 5-10% tactical commodity allocation as an inflation hedge in taxable portfolios, PDBC is among the most efficient options available today. The fund’s optimum yield roll strategy has delivered measurable value over its lifecycle: our analysis shows that dynamic rolling has reduced annual roll yield drag by an average of 85 basis points per year relative to front-month fixed-roll commodity funds, accounting for roughly 12% of PDBC’s 5-year excess return over the Bloomberg Commodity Index. That said, investors should be mindful of structural tradeoffs. The 21% U.S. corporate income tax applied to PDBC’s net gains before distributions reduces after-tax returns by an estimated 130 basis points annually for investors holding the fund in Roth IRAs or other tax-exempt accounts, where the K-1 administrative burden carries no financial cost. For these investors, partnership-structured commodity funds may deliver higher net returns if they are able to absorb the K-1 filing complexity. It is also important to note that PDBC does not eliminate contango risk entirely: in periods of extreme forward curve steepness, the fund will still underperform spot commodity returns, as roll costs can only be reduced, not erased.
